How Trimec 1000 Works

Trimec 1000 herbicide contains four essential ingredients for tough weed control: 2,4-D diethanolamine salt, 2,4-D dimethylamine salt, MCPP and dicamba. This unique formulation is specially made to kill the hardest weeds, even those with deep roots. It's applied as a spray and starts to work on contact as the ingredients are translocated throughout the plant.

Though it's tough on weeds, the treated area can be reseeded in only three weeks after application. With four combined ingredients, visual results can be seen within days.

Where to Use Trimec Herbicide

Use Trimec 1000 Low-Odor Broadleaf Herbicide in most residential areas to kill tough weeds without the lingering smell. It can be applied on golf course fairways and roughs, as well as most sports turf. Use it to kill weeds on commercial properties, sod farms and other non-crop turf areas.

It can be applied to tall, red, and fine leaf fescue. Apply it on Kentucky and annual bluegrass, annual and perennial ryegrass, and common and hybrid Bermudagrass. It's also labeled for use on zoysiagrass, buffalograss and bahiagrass. It works in locations up to 90 degrees Fahrenheit and has a low-odor formulation to make killing weeds much more bearable in populated areas.

Target Weeds

Trimec 1000 is perfect for use in cool-season and warm-season grasses to kill more than 90 different broadleaf weeds. It's perfect for getting rid of dandelions and unwanted clover patches, as well as chickweed where it's established on the lawn. It can also be used to knock down plantain, bindweed and thistle, including chicory and deadnettle. Use Trimec herbicide to kill the following weeds and more:

  • Dogfennel
  • Henbit
  • Knotweed
  • Poison ivy
  • Ragweed

Trimec 1000 Features and Benefits

Because it contains four ingredients, Trimec 1000 is highly effective at killing the hardest to control weeds on cool- and warm-season grasses. It controls nearly 100 different broadleaf weeds and is rainfast in just eight hours. Other benefits include:

  • Low-odor formula
  • Perfect for golf course fairways
  • For use across residential lawns
  • Reseeding in only 3 weeks
  • Kills deep-rooted perennial weeds

A Powerful Weed Killer Without the Odor

When the lawn is overrun with difficult weeds, use Trimec 1000 Low-Odor Broadleaf Herbicide to kill them fast. It's the perfect herbicide to kill weeds on bluegrass, fescue, ryegrass and more. It's rainfast in only eight hours, stays active up to 90 degrees Fahrenheit, and delivers the most effective post-emergent control of weeds on a variety of properties.
